Dale County took a six-run loss the last time they faced off against Andalusia, but this time they managed to keep it close and that made all the difference. The Warriors won by a run and slipped past the Bulldogs 2-1. This was payback for the Warriors, who suffered a 15-9 defeat the last time these two teams met.
The team relied heavily on AK Snellgrove,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-2. That stolen base marked the first that she snagged this season. Madyson McLain was another key player, scoring a run and stealing a base while going 1-for-1.
The win snapped Dale County's losing streak at four games and leaves them with a 16-8 record. As for Andalusia, their loss dropped their record down to 17-7.
Coincidentally, Dale County and Andalusia will both be playing Straughn the next time they take the field. The Bulldogs will head out to face the Tigers at 4:30 p.m. on Friday, while the Warriors will play them later in the day, at 6:00 p.m.
